Patricia Heintzman was elected mayor of Squamish with 47.97% of the votes.
Candidate Name | Incumbent | Votes | Percentage | Total | Elected |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Heintzman, Patricia | 47.97% | 2900 | |||
Kirkham, Rob | 43.19% | 2611 | |||
Bahm, Ron | 7.08% | 428 |

Councillor Doug Race (Incumbent) received the highest number of votes, 2,359 out of a possible 6,045.
In 2014 the estimated eligible voter turnout for the Squamish (District) was 49.6%, which was 15.1% higher than than the average BC municipal turnout of 34.5%.
Women make up 42.9% of this Council. The BC average for municipal councils is 36.9%.
Elected incumbency rate of 60% is 20.8% lower than BC average of 80.8%.
